BERLIN (AP) — The head of the United Nations warned Friday that the entire world faces “catastrophe” because of the rising scarcity of meals all around the globe.
U.N. Secretary-Typical Antonio Guterres said the war in Ukraine has included to the disruptions induced by local weather modify, the coronavirus pandemic and inequality to generate an “unprecedented world wide starvation crisis” now influencing hundreds of hundreds of thousands of folks.
“There is a authentic hazard that numerous famines will be declared in 2022,” he mentioned in a online video message to officers from dozens of loaded and acquiring nations around the world collected in Berlin. “And 2023 could be even worse.”
Guterres mentioned that harvests throughout Asia, Africa and the Americas will take a strike as farmers all over the planet wrestle to cope with growing fertilizer and electrical power selling prices.
“This year’s foodstuff entry troubles could turn out to be following year’s worldwide foodstuff scarcity,” he mentioned. “No state will be immune to the social and financial repercussions of this sort of a disaster.”
Guterres mentioned U.N. negotiators had been functioning on a deal that would allow Ukraine to export food items, which includes through the Black Sea, and permit Russia convey foods and fertilizer to world marketplaces with out limits.
He also termed for financial debt aid for lousy countries to enable retain their economies afloat and for the private sector to assist stabilize international foods markets.
The Berlin meeting’s host, German International Minister Annalena Baerbock, explained Moscow’s declare that Western sanctions imposed around Russia’s invasion of Ukraine have been to blame for foods shortages was “completely untenable.”
Russia exported as significantly wheat in Could and June this calendar year as in the same months of 2021, Baerbock said.
She echoed Guterres’ responses that many things underlie the expanding hunger disaster all around the earth.
“But it was Russia’s war of assault towards Ukraine that turned a wave into a tsunami,” Baerbock explained.
U.S. Secretary of Point out Antony Blinken insisted that Russia has no excuse for holding again crucial merchandise from globe marketplaces.
“The sanctions that we’ve imposed on Russia collectively and with numerous other nations around the world exempt food items, exempt food products, exempt fertilizers, exempt insurers, exempt shippers,” he claimed.
